Shawn Hornbeck

 


Shawn Hornbeck went missing in 2002 at the age of 11. He was riding his bike to a friend’s house when he was abducted by Michael Devlin and was held captive in Michael’s apartment for the next four and a half years. The best documentary I can find on Shawn is here

The most noteworthy aspect of Shawn’s case is his rescue. In January of 2007, his captor abducted another boy named Ben Ownby. There was one witness to Ben’s abduction, a teenage boy who was getting off the school bus with Ben. This teenager had a very intense obsession with trucks and gave the police such a detailed description of the truck that it nearly made him look suspicious. Law enforcement still decided to publish the detailed description, which is what ultimately led to the discovery of both Ben and Shawn alive in Devlin’s apartment. 

Another noteworthy part of Shawn’s rescue was the victim blaming by Bill O’Reilly. Shawn made it very clear in interviews later on how his captor had complete control over him, even when not physically present. Shawn has never written a book about his ordeal, and I believe the victim blaming was the main reason for that. Because he never wrote a book, details of his captivity aren’t well known.
